Transaction 27255bd6328fb4ab92bc1bf957fc1f25717c097ace566208a3b3e14f66018686
1 Input
1 Output
-
27255bd6328fb4ab92bc1bf957fc1f25717c097ace566208a3b3e14f66018686:0
- value
- 6780258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 201dc659caad3c095cd434b63a2ba4176587a8b0 OP_EQUAL
- address
- 34cqDULq6vidGiJdsbmHvw6SQmLYBZCuLX